import { getUuid } from "pdfjs-lib";
class SignatureStorage {
// TODO: Encrypt the data in using a password and add a UI for entering it.
// We could use the Web Crypto API for this (see https://bradyjoslin.com/blog/encryption-webcrypto/
// for an example).
#signatures = null;
#save() {
localStorage.setItem("pdfjs.signature", JSON.stringify(this.#signatures));
}
async getAll() {
if (!this.#signatures) {
const data = localStorage.getItem("pdfjs.signature");
this.#signatures = data ? JSON.parse(data) : Object.create(null);
}
return this.#signatures;
}
async isFull() {
return Object.keys(await this.getAll()).length === 5;
}
async create(data) {
if (await this.isFull()) {
return null;
}
const uuid = getUuid();
this.#signatures[uuid] = data;
this.#save();
return uuid;
}
async delete(uuid) {
const signatures = await this.getAll();
if (!signatures[uuid]) {
return false;
}
delete signatures[uuid];
this.#save();
return true;
}
async update(uuid, data) {
const signatures = await this.getAll();
const oldData = signatures[uuid];
if (!oldData) {
return false;
}
Object.assign(oldData, data);
this.#save();
return true;
}
}
export { SignatureStorage };
